If you’re chomping at the bit to know what horror auteur Mike Flanagan is doing next, we have good news for you: the Fall of the House of Usher creator will be serving as special guest moderator for Blumhouse’s “BlumFest” appearance at this year’s New York Comic Con, where he’ll help unveil a whole new slate of scares for 2025 alongside comedian Nicole Byer. 

For those lucky enough to attend NYCC, the panel is scheduled for this Friday, October 18, at 2:30PM ET in the Javits Center’s Empire Room, and will also feature Blumhouse CEO and founder Jason Blum as they reveal the company’s plans to celebrate their upcoming fifteenth anniversary in 2025. Along with James Wan’s Atomic Monster, they’ll be giving fans a special look at their slate for 2025, as well as a peek at their first ever video game. The full line-up will include the following:

  • The heart-stopping world premiere trailer debut for Wolf Man, directed by horror visionary Leigh Whannell. This will be followed by a Q&A session with Whannell, bringing fans inside his creative vision for the film.   
  • Exclusive first-look footage from Christopher Landon's Drop, starring Meghann Fahy, and a Q&A with the director and actress.
  • An exclusive first look at Jaume Collet-Serra's The Woman in the Yard, starring and executive produced by Danielle Deadwyler.
  • A Q&A with M3GAN 2.0 star and producer Allison Williams, plus a special message just for NYCC attendees from M3GAN herself. 
  • The scares don't end with film. BlumFest will also pull back the curtain with a trailer for Fear the Spotlight, Blumhouse's first video game.

Some of this footage will be exclusive to attendees at the panel, as well as appearances from some other unnamed friends of the horror house, which is certain to be drop-dead fun. Flanagan will moderate the numerous Q&As, while Byer will emcee the whole event, which looks to be the cornerstone for horror at this year’s convention.
